Finance Review Summary — Orvanne Industrial, Q3
For: Branch Managers

The hiring freeze applies solely to the Fittings Division, effective immediately, covering all permanent and contract roles. Payroll growth there had exceeded plan by 12%, driven by the Hallowmere line expansion. Other divisions remain unaffected. Backfill requests require divisional director approval. The wider planning context is provided in the confidential note below.

management briefing: The renewal with Quenathox Group closes at $10 million a year, 20 percent below the last contract. Project Ulawyn slips by two quarters because of the supplier delay.

## Factory Capacity — Managers Only

Heads up, sales leads: the Renholt plant is moving to two-shift operation from October, which lifts output on the Pintail range by roughly thirty percent. Don't promise customers more than that — Marbeck line tooling is still constrained until spring. Quote standard lead times and escalate anything chunky to Iris Dannock. The bigger picture on why we're expanding is in the note below.

board note of bajop-yaweg: The western region missed its Pelys quota by 58.0 percent last quarter. Pelysek Foods plans to raise the Belius list price by 44.0 percent in July. The steering committee signed off on a budget of $133.8 million for Project Pelax. The renewal with Zoraelix Systems closes at $61.9 million a year, 12.7 percent above the last contract.

## Partner SFTP Drop — Marlowe Freight

Files land nightly between 02:00–03:30 UTC in the inbound drop. Watcher job `marlowe-ingest` picks them up; if nothing arrives by 04:00, the Quillhook alert fires. Do NOT re-request files from Marlowe before checking the quarantine folder — malformed headers get parked there silently. Retries are safe; ingest is idempotent on file checksum. Rotation of the drop credentials is quarterly, owned by platform. Full escalation steps and contacts are on the runbook page.

dashboard of taduf-tahof = https://confluence.tolvaqlabs.internal/browse/browse/display/f01240ca